Exegesis
The noun `hachukkah {הַחֻקָּה | ha-ḥuqqāh} ‘the statute’` is specified by the demonstrative `hazot {הַזֹּאת | ha-zōṯ} ‘this’`, focusing on a particular ordinance.
In context — Exodus 13:10
Therefore you shall keep this statute at its appointed time , year after year.
